The Mechanics of Squeezing the Pixels: A Technical Overview
Squeezing the pixels – the fundamental principle behind image compression – relies on the reduction of digital data required to represent an image. This can be achieved through various methods, each with its unique benefits and limitations.
Lossless Compression Techniques
One of the primary methods is lossless compression, which preserves the image's original quality and fidelity. Techniques such as Huffman coding, arithmetic coding, and LZ77 algorithms are employed to minimize the file size while maintaining the visual integrity of the image.

Do These Techniques Affect Image Quality?
The answer to this question hinges on the type of compression technique employed. While lossless compression methods preserve image quality, lossy compression techniques may sacrifice some resolution in the process.
However, for many applications, the trade-off between image quality and file size is worth it, especially when considering the potential benefits of reduced storage requirements and faster data transfer rates.
